Some of you may recall that I came back on 25OCT16 with the idea of having a revision.  My surgeon requested I have a barium swallow and EGD and send him the results for evaluation to see if a revision is what I need.  Meanwhile, I got back on plan.  I have spent the most of the past two months in ketosis (pee-euww) and have lost 22lbs.  I'm thinking the little booger is still working.

The GI doc gave me pics.  Results:

Linearly eroded, abnormal (rule out Barrett's esophagus) mucosa in the esophagus - biopsied.

Medium sized Hiatal hernia

A sleeve gastrectomy was found, characterized by healthy appearing mucosa. (!!!!!!!!!!!!)

And she did a couple biopsies after my tummy.

 

Anyway, she's trying me on a new, prescription strength PPI.  She may also recommend a hernia repair. 

Then, I just wait to hear back from Dr. A.  But I think things look great!!!
